Output ec386f5f869670f6511843046037ce9aa0e07c9f28cc10081609ca3338e0523c:22

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b72628fd90495055fd059f02e4240a44784710e OP_EQUALVERIFY OP_CHECKSIG
address
123XTikMEV4VNoyj1hQnZ9YWw4Jqwbbe2p
transaction
ec386f5f869670f6511843046037ce9aa0e07c9f28cc10081609ca3338e0523c
spent
true